Class 6 Maths Questions and Answers

Practice the following important Class 6th Maths Quiz containing MCQ type Questions to prepare for the upcoming Class 6 Maths Exam 2022:

Question 1: Using the digits 3, 5, 7, 0 without repetition the greatest 4-digit number that can be made is

(a) 7530
(b) 7503
(c) 7350
(d) 7305

Answer: Option (a)

Question 2: The smallest of the numbers 2325, 2352, 2235, 2253, 2523, 2532 is

(a) 2235
(b) 2253
(c) 2325
(d) 2532

Answer: Option (a)

Question 3: The smallest 4-digit number that can be made using the digits 1,8,5,3 without repetition is

(a) 1583
(b) 1538
(c) 1385
(d) 1358

Answer: Option (d)

Question 4: Using the digits 1, 5, 7, 2 without repetition, the greatest 4-digit number that can be made is

(a) 7521
(b) 7512
(c) 7215
(d) 7251

Answer: Option (a)

Question 5: Using the digits 1, 2, 3, 4 without repetition, the greatest 4-digit number that can be made is

(a) 4321
(b) 4312
(c) 4213
(d) 4231

Answer: Option (a)

Question 6: The difference between the successor and the predecessor of a number is

(a) 1
(b) 2
(c) -1
(d) -2

Answer: Option (b)

Question 7: The difference between the predecessor of a number and the number itself is

(a) 1
(b) -1
(c) 2
(d) -2.

Answer: Option (b)

Question 8: The natural number that has no predecessor is

(a) 1
(b) 10
(c) 100
(d) 1000

Answer: Option (a)

Question 9: The difference between the successor of a number and the number itself is

(a) 0
(b) – 1
(c) 1
(d) None of these

Answer: Option (c)

Question 10: To find the predecessor of a number, we have to subtract what from the number itself?

(a) 1
(b) 2
(c) 3
(d) 4

Answer: Option (a)

Question 11: The smallest common factor of 4, 12, and 16 is

(a) 1
(b) 2
(c) 4
(d) 8

Answer: Option (a)

Question 12: The LCM of 9 and 45 is

(a) 3
(b) 9
(c) 5
(d) 45

Answer: Option (d)

Question 13: The HCF of 36 and 84 is

(a) 3
(b) 4
(c) 6
(d) 12

Answer: Option (d)

Question 14: The LCM of 12 and 48 is

(a) 6
(b) 12
(c) 24
(d) 48

Answer: Option (d)

Question 15: The HCF of 30 and 42 is

(a) 2
(b) 3
(c) 5
(d) 6

Answer: Option (d)

Question 16: The LCM of 6 and 18 is

(a) 6
(b) 12
(c) 18
(d) 36

Answer: Option (c)

Question 17: The LCM of 5 and 20 is

(a) 5
(b) 10
(c) 15
(d) 20

Answer: Option (d)

Question 18: Through what angle measure does the hour hand of a clock turn when it goes from 12 to 9?

(a) 270°
(b) 180°
(c) 360°
(d) 90°

Answer: Option (a)

Question 19: Through what angle does the hour hand of a clock turn, when it goes from 6 to 3?

(a) 90°
(b) 180°
(c) 270°
(d) 360°

Answer: Option (c)

Question 20: Through what angle measure does the hour hand of a clock turn when it goes from 5 to 8?

(a) 90°
(b) 180°
(c) 360°
(d) none of these.

Answer: Option (a)

Question 21: 9 + (- 9) = ?

(a) 9
(b) -9
(c) 1
(d) 0

Answer: Option (d)

Question 22: ? – 4 = – 2

(a) 1
(b) 2
(c) 3
(d) 4

Answer: Option (b)

Question 23: ? – 5 = – 5

(a) 0
(b) 5
(c) -5
(d) 1

Answer: Option (a)

Question 24: (- 1) + ? = – 2

(a) 1
(b) – 1
(c) 0
(d) 2

Answer: Option (b)

Question 25: 2 – (- 1) – 2 – (- 3) =

(a) 0
(b) 3
(c) 2
(d) 4

Answer: Option (d)

How To Prepare Mathematics?

  • Practice, Practice & More Practice to get efficient as it’s impossible to study maths properly by just reading and listening
  • Learn all formulas at your tips
  • Master the basic concept of each topic
  • Understand your Doubts and discuss them with your teacher/mentor
  • Create a Distraction-Free Study Environment
  • Create a Mathematical Dictionary
  • Apply Maths to Real-World Problems
  • Solve questions every day.
  • Practice with best-recommended books
  • Do regular practice with the previous year’s papers
